† Wycliffize, v. Obs. rare—1. In 7 Wicclifize. [f. as prec. + -ize.] intr. To espouse or advocate the views of Wycliffe (esp. as to Church property).
1655Fuller Ch. Hist. vi. 302 The Lay Parliament,..which did wholly Wicclifize, kept in the twelfth year of King Henry the fourth. |
